FR9 WebNov 29, 2024 · As a consequence of low silica concentration in the lake, larger and nutritious diatom species such as Melosira sp., Stephanodiscus astraea and Aulacoseira nyassensis var. victoriae have become rare while smaller diatoms such as Nitzschia acicularis are dominating the pelagic diatom community (Lehman and Branstator 1994; Verschuren et …

This shift … WebA lakewide reorganization of diatom assemblages occurred around 7200 BP, when Aulacoseira nyassensis largely replaced A. granulata and after which rainfall and wind-driven mixing became more seasonally restricted.
